SweatyYaya is a blog created to help Yoga St. Louis Intro students with building a home practice. SweatyYaya is a memorable mispronunciation of the Sanskrit word: svadhyaya. Svadhyaya is the practice of self-study and is one of the niyamas (observances) presented in the Yoga Sutras of Patanjali.

Friday 6:00a Asana 1: Week 6 (Apr 10, 2009)


NOTE: This is an Asana 1 class and not for beginners. All students have been attending classes at Yoga St. Louis for at least one year.

5 students, one on her menstrual period. Focus of the class on preparing for seated forward bends.

1. Tadasana

2. Virabhadrasana 2
2x;
2nd into...

3. Utthita Parsva Konasana

4. Uttanasana

5. Virabhadrasana 1

6. Uttanasana
Repeat and deepen;
Keep hips over heels, not leaning back;

7. Utthita Trikonasana
2x;
2nd into...

8. Utthita Parsva Konasana
Return to...

9. Utthita Trikonasana
Into...

10. Ardha Chandrasana
Into...

11. Parsvottanasana
Into...

12. Uttanasana
Return to Tadasana and repeat cycle of poses #7 - #12 on other side;

13. Virabhadrasana 1

14. Prasarita Padottanasana

15. Virasana
Sit on heels;

16. Adho Mukha Virasana
Knees apart;
Actively extend arms to prepare for...

17. Adho Mukha Svanasana
2x;

18. Purvottanasana
2x; roll upper arms back & push through palms, triceps firm;
1st: knees bent, feet on floor;
2nd: legs straight;

19. Adho Mukha Svanasana

20. Dandasana

21. Janu Sirsasana
If lifted, prop knee on brick or blanket;

22. Dandasana

23. Ardha Baddha Padma Paschimottanasana
Cradle ankle as you move it to upper thigh, bending forward to keep knee low;
If lifted, prop knee on brick or blanket;

24. Dandasana

25. Triang Mukhaikpada Paschimottanasana
Sit on brick or blanket under extended leg buttock to balance hips;
If cannot reach hands to foot, use belt;

26. Dandasana

27. Savasana
